George James HAMMOND

Regimental number3522
Place of birthFremantle Western Australia
ReligionChurch of England
OccupationCook
AddressFremantle, Western Australia
Marital statusSingle
Age at embarkation21
Next of kinMother, Mrs Mary Ann Hammond, 111 Alexandra Road, Beaconsfield, Fremantle, Western Australia
Enlistment date27 April 1917
Rank on enlistmentPrivate
Unit name44th Battalion, 9th Reinforcement
AWM Embarkation Roll number23/61/3
Embarkation detailsUnit embarked from Albany, Western Australia, on board HMAT A16 Port Melbourne on 24 July 1917
Rank from Nominal RollPrivate
Unit from Nominal Roll44th Battalion
Recommendations (Medals and Awards)

Mention in Despatches


Recommendation date: 1 October 1917

FateReturned to Australia
Miscellaneous details (Nominal Roll)Nominal Roll incorrectly lists date of return to Australia as 21 February 1917.
Family/military connectionsBrother: 3862 Pte Joseph James HAMMOND, 51st Bn, returned to Australia, 7 February 1919.
Other details

War service: Western Front

Medals: British War Medal, Victory Medal
